pet shop
pet store dubaipet shop dubaipet supplies dubaiTake a look at our pet store in Dubai or investigate our online shop to find out the best products on your pets. Believe in us to generally be your spouse in providing a cheerful, balanced, and fulfilling everyday living to your beloved companions.Within the Pet Shop, we're enthusiastic about what we d